## Tuning

Telemetry payloads from Wrenpost agents are batched, compressed, then shipped. Bigger batches compress better but hurt latency and memory on the tiny Kestrel-class edge boxes. Compression level 6 was the sweet spot in our benchmarks; 9 gained almost nothing. Change values only with a benchmark run attached to the PR. Defaults live in config/telemetry.toml and mirror what's shown here.

constants for fajop-tahaf:
RATE_LIMITS = {
    "holael": 2,
    "oliael": 10,
    "druael": 10,
    "wenwyn": 10,
}

**Action Item 4: Fix the health check blind spot**

So, fun fact: the Bramblegate load balancer kept routing traffic to app nodes whose health endpoint returned 200 even though the worker pool underneath was completely wedged. We need the check to actually exercise a real code path, not just ping the framework. Owner: the Pelora platform crew, due end of sprint. Background on how our health checks are wired up lives here:

runbook for badug-kadup: https://confluence.zemvarlabs.internal/projects/browse/display/projects/bd1b

### Action Item: Spoolhaven Retry Storm

From last Tuesday's outage: the Spoolhaven print service retried failed jobs without backoff, saturating the render pool. Fix merged; retries now use capped exponential backoff with jitter. Owner will monitor for a week before closing. The agreed retry constants are recorded below.

constants for yadup-kajof:
RATE_LIMITS = {
    "zorwyn": 1,
    "druwyn": 1,
}

Hey — handing off the Torchgate token mess before I log off. Short version: refresh requests race when two tabs renew the same session, and the loser gets a revoked token, which is why users in the Keld region keep getting bounced to login. I shipped a mutex on the refresh path, but it only helps if the grace window is long enough. If it flares up again, bump the window before anything else. Current settings are pasted below.

settings of tagef-bawif:
DRUIX_HOST=druix.zemvarlabs.internal
DRUIX_PORT=8000